Equity, Eco Plumbers break ground on new flex industrial building

Hilliard-based commercial real estate developer Equity hosted a groundbreaking event Thursday for its new $29 million, 158,000-square-foot flex industrial building set to be built on 19-plus acres of land east of Britton Parkway near I-270.

The growth continues for one of Hilliard’s largest employers, Eco Plumbers, Electricians, and HVAC Technicians.

Eco Plumbers, Electricians, and HVAC Technicians will be the building’s anchor tenant, and the expansion will create 60 new positions for the company. The Britton Flex facility also has an additional 100,000 square feet of space still available for other businesses.

The groundbreaking event included remarks from Equity Founder and CEO Steve Wathen, Eco Plumbers Founder and CEO Aaron Gaynor, and Hilliard City Manager Michelle Crandall. The 19-plus acre site is located east of Britton Parkway near Mount Carmel Hilliard and Advanced Drainage Systems' new research and development facility.
